If you don't have animals (or a floating, silvered helium balloon - it happened to me!) setting the alarm off, then it's most likely a faulty sensor - and/ or an infra red one with a cobweb over it. The infra red sensors can last as few as 5 years, and do need to be kept clean of cobwebs. Also the back-up batteries (in case of mains failure) only now have a 3-4 year life, and will need replacing. It's possible that's what triggering the alarm to sound.


I have found Martin Curry of Security Masters (independent in Herne Hill - 07947 321 132) very good and helpful. He will at least be able to isolate the alarm to stop it going off.

> That won't help if it's mains powered.


Even if you disconnect the mains and remove the battery, most alarms will still sound because they are ultimately powered by a large capacitor.


This is a safety issue to stop burglars cutting the mains power and removing the battery.


Hence when there is a power cut, if the alarm sounds it means the battery is flat and so it cannot keep the sounder circuit open. In this event, the capacitor steps in and powers the sounder.
